About the Role: As a Software Development Engineer you will design, build, and maintain integration workflows on the Zynk Workflow Integration Platform as a Service (iPaaS). You will leverage your expertise in C#, XML/XSLT, JSON, and modern data‑integration patterns to deliver robust, scalable solutions that connect e‑commerce, CRM, accounting, and other business systems for our customers.
Key Responsibilities:
- Workflow Design & Development – Author, optimise, and document workflows in Zynk Workflow Studio, orchestrating complex data flows that transform, enrich, and route information between disparate systems.
- Component Engineering – Extend the Zynk platform by developing new C# task adapters, connectors, and utilities that integrate REST/SOAP/GraphQL APIs, databases, and file systems.
- Data Transformation – Craft reusable XML schemas, XSLT stylesheets, and JSON mappings to translate between canonical and application‑specific data models.
- Integration Delivery – Apply integration patterns such as publish/subscribe, request/reply, file‑drop, and event‑driven processing across on‑premises and cloud endpoints.
- Quality & Observability – Implement integration tests, configure logging and metrics, diagnose performance bottlenecks, and ensure SLAs are consistently met.
- Collaboration – Partner with Solution Architects, Support Engineers, and end‑users to gather requirements, provide estimates, and iterate rapidly on feedback.
- Continuous Improvement – Contribute to coding standards, documentation, and internal knowledge‑base articles; mentor junior engineers and champion best practices.
